Any characters you type will be placed into the puzzle at the focus cell which is outlined in red. The focus cell can be moved around the
puzzle by pointing and clicking with the mouse, or by means of the arrow keys.
The program maintains the set of candidate symbols which could legally be placed in each cell. In the default mode of operation, these candidate
symbols are displayed within each unsolved cell. You can remove candidate symbols from the display by pointing to them, and clicking with the mouse.
When you remove the last candidate symbol from a cell, it becomes the solution for that cell. If you prefer to work without the candidate symbols,
